Blue Ocean Announces Virgin Islands Court Grants Injunction Order Prohibiting Golden Meditech from Taking Any Steps on a Purported Share Charge from Blue Ocean or Pursuing the Removal of Blue Ocean's Representative as a Director of Global Cord BloodBlue Ocean Structure Investment Company Ltd. ("Blue Ocean"), a significant shareholder of Global Cord Blood Corporation (the "Company" or "Global Cord") (NYSE: CO), today announced that the Eastern Caribbean Supreme Court in the High Court of Justice of the Virgin Islands (the "Court") granted an injunction order ("the Order") enjoining Golden Meditech Stem Cells (BVI) Company Limited ("Golden Meditech") from taking any steps on a purported share charge from Blue Ocean and from pursuing the removal of Blue Ocean's representative, Xu Ping, as a Director of Global Cord. Blue Ocean, whose investment in Global Cord represents an ownership position of approximately 65% of the Company's shares, has stated its intent to take all possible actions to stop Global Cord's planned acquisition (the "Transaction") of Cellenkos, Inc. ("Cellenkos"). In response to a distracting and fraudulent Schedule 13D filing made by Golden Meditech with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ission on 23 May 2022, Blue Ocean filed an injunction order in the Court.
